Scope and content
Trinity College - WW sends RJ a package from John Herschel: 'You will be pleased to see his unfailing affection for the Inductive Philosophy, and I hope it will put you in mind that you, as well as he and I, are bound by our early principles to go on working in our respected ways at our departments of sound speculative science'. RJ should not waste all his time on legislation and politics - 'So get your little Pamphlet finished as fast as you can and then take to general views again' ['Remarks on the Government Bill for the Commutation of Tithe', 1836].
